In Spanish, fuego means "fire," and this place takes its name seriously. There are not only spicy dishes on the menu, but actual flambéed dishes as well. The atmosphere is slightly formal but unpretentious. Waiters bustle about serving such flavorful dishes as the signature Field of Greens salad, with blue cheese, chile-roasted walnuts, and dried cranberries, or prickly-pear pork tenderloin...

Dark wood and brick in the dining rooms lend Fuego Restaurant Bar & Grill a country-style atmosphere. The patio is large and lively. The menu emphasizes fresh, local ingredients and includes ostrich and game specialties. A "game harvest of the week" special features everything from buffalo to elk and venison.
